Designing User Interfaces for Android Games

Android games have become increasingly popular over the years, and to keep up with the competition, developers must create engaging user interfaces (UI) to keep players engaged. A great UI can be the difference between a successful mobile game and one that quickly fades into obscurity. Below, we will discuss some of the key considerations for designing effective user interfaces for Android games.

1. Make the UI Intuitive

The UI should be designed to be intuitive and easy to understand. All menus and controls should be easy to navigate and understand. Avoid using complex layouts or confusing menus that may be difficult to comprehend. Additionally, be sure to provide visual cues and feedback to let players know they’re making progress.

2. Keep It Simple

When designing a UI for an Android game, keep it simple. Avoid cluttering the screen with too much information or too many options. The goal should be to make the game as easy to understand and play as possible. Also, less is more when it comes to UI elements. Too many buttons and menus can be overwhelming and can lead to confusion.

3. Design for Touchscreens

Android games are played on touchscreen devices, and the UI should be designed to take advantage of this. Buttons should be large enough to be tapped easily, and menus should be clearly organized for easy navigation. Additionally, be aware of how the UI will look on different size devices and make sure it looks good regardless of the device size.

4. Utilize Animations

Animations can be a great way to make a UI more engaging and immersive. Animations can be used to provide feedback to the player or to show progress through a level. However, be sure to use animations sparingly as too many can be distracting.

5. Consider Accessibility

When designing a UI, consider how it can be made accessible to players with disabilities. This may require making adjustments to the UI to ensure it can be used by players with visual or hearing impairments.
